GenioMaestro Posted August 31, 2018 Posted August 31, 2018 T-pose is caused by Fnis at 99% but Fnis NEED the correct skeleton and the CORRECT animations for work. 11 hours ago, Avian1355 said: FNIS Behavior V7.4.5 8/30/2018 4:45:17 PMSkyrim 32bit: 1.9.32.0 - C:\Program Files (x86)\Steam\steamapps\common\Skyrim\ (Steam) Skeleton(hkx) female: XPMS2HDT (115 bones) male: XPMS2HDT (115 bones) Patch: "SKELETON Arm Fix" First, you are ussing Oldrim 32 bits, as show in your first fnis log, and all the main tools have a DIFERENT version for 32 and 64 bits and NEVER can be mixed. Second, you need the skeleton XPMSE from Grovtama and you have it, as show in your first fnis log. Normally, 90% of people use the hdt skeleton of 115 bones, is the skeleton that i use, and i have cero problems and is the skeleton that i think you must use. The original original from your first post. Forget the others skeltons, like XPMS (242 bones) or BBP (129 bones), probably only can give you problems. Use ALWAYS the same skeleton that your KNOW that work perfect, and that normally is Skeleton(hkx) female: XPMS2HDT (115 bones) male: XPMS2HDT (115 bones) Never confuse the OLD skeleton with the NEW skeleton: XP32 Maximum Skeleton Extended - XPMSE (YOU NEED THIS) is not exactly the same that XP32 Maximum Skeleton - XPMS (NOT USE THIS) Next, the animation system for skyrim is DIFERENT for 32 and 64 bits and the Behavior.hkx files FOR EACH MOD are diferent for 32 and 64 bits. As your log say, you have the 64 bits version of Deviously Cursed Loot when you have oldrim 32 bits. I presume this is all your problem. 11 hours ago, Avian1355 said: >>Warning: \character\behaviors\FNIS_Deviously Cursed Loot_Behavior.hkx not Skyrim compatible<< Reading Deviously Cursed Loot V6.3 ( 0 furniture, 1 offset, 0 paired, 0 kill, 0 chair, 0 alternate animations) ... Simply remove, un-install and totally delete your 64 bits version of Deviously Cursed Loot and run Fnis again. MUST SAY 0 ERRORS. If you have any error probably fnis are not executed correctly and you get t-pose again. Solve all the errors that fnish show. While you have errors in fnis you always get t-pose. When your game run good, if you want, download and install the 32 bits version of Deviously Cursed Loot.
